Monday 28th May

Kingston to Weybridge

Mark came along to Kingston to help me get off the Thames and onto the River Wey at Shepperton. There was quite a strong current due to the weirs being opened to get the levels back down to normal. It was also very cold due to the wind. With Marks advice I went round the wrong side of some of the islands. Had lunch en route.

The hairiest bit was going across the bottom of the weir at Shepperton to get to the Wey. There was a very strong current which bounced off the oppsite bank causing a whirlpool in front of the mouth of the Wey.

We did not need to use the gates on the outer pound at Thames lock to get over the cill as the level was 3ft higher than usual!

Moored above the lock for the night. We were collected by car from here to be taken back to the real world for the evening.
